Milton Tutoring FAQ
Milton, WA, is a city that is shared by the counties of King and Pierce. The population in the city is 7,000. The city prides itself on its beautiful and scenic parks and trail system.
There is not a High School in Milton, but students in the city primarily attend Fife High School, which is served by Fife School District. There are several attractions in the Milton area to explore and enjoy. The city has several parks to play, bike, or shoot some hoops in. Milton Community Park has tennis courts for you and your competitive friends to use, while others swing their bats in the baseball fields. For the biker and runner in you, try out the paved trails of the Interurban Trail, which has a beautiful scenic element to it that you will love as you get your morning exercise. Take a day off to relax and experience the beauty of Five Mile Lake Park, which has a lake and state-of-the-art park to go along with it. This park is amazing for any type of party, especially in the summer when guests can go swimming in the lake. You could also utilize the trails around the lake for a scenic bike ride with a friend in the evening. Make a splash at the Wild Waves Theme Park, a waterpark and amusement park duo, which is fun for the whole family. Schedule a day to go to Trampoline Nation with some friends, and jump around in the fun facility. It's not only a lot of fun, it also doubles as a lot of exercise, too.
